Handover for Ilse — the Drayfield calendar sync is still double-booking when the Quorill feed and local edits collide within the same minute. I added a tiebreaker on sequence number in `conflict_resolver.py`; please review the edge case where both sides lack one. The staging reconciler is locked behind the recovery console, and it will ask for the passphrase before replaying events. It is the following.

strongbox words: fraath-isteth

Subject: Queue cut-over complete — plugin notes

Hi all, happy to report the switch from our homegrown job queue to Taskloom went live last night. Plugins targeting the old enqueue API will keep working through the shim until next quarter, but please migrate to the new dispatch hooks soon — retries and priorities behave differently. To test your plugins against something realistic, point them at staging, which now runs with these configuration values.

deployment values, kajep-kageg:
[praix]
host = praix.paliqcorp.corp
user = praix_svc
database = praix_prod

## Sample Shipments to Veltrane Labs

All tissue and soil samples bound for Veltrane Labs in Orrisfield must be double-bagged, logged in the outbound ledger, and packed in the insulated blue cases stored in Room 4. Cold packs should be replaced no more than two hours before pickup. The office manager confirms the manifest against the freezer log and signs both copies before sealing the case. Pickups occur Tuesdays and Thursdays only. The courier from Brydall Express must follow the hand-over instruction below.

courier memo of yawep-yafog: the pramir ulaix courier leaves the ulavan aldix frair zorok oliiel joreth rusdor fenvan ledger at gate 1305 under passcode 514738

# Notes for weekly eng sync — Pellmire migrations.
# Zero-downtime schema changes now run via the dual-write shim in Corvette Gate.
# Expand phase ships Tuesday; contract phase after traffic confirms parity.
# Do not run the contract step manually.
# The shim authenticates against the Harrowfen replica pool, and the line below this comment sets that credential.

secret setting of yafof-tawep: RELAY_SECRET8=8abb5772